Exploring Bangkok: The Heart of Thailand
Bangkok is the capital city of Thailand and is often referred to as the “City of Angels”. It’s a bustling metropolis that is home to over 8 million people and is known for its vibrant street life, delicious food, and impressive temples. One of the most popular tourist attractions in Bangkok is the Grand Palace, which is a complex of buildings that was once the residence of the King of Thailand. The palace is home to several temples, including Wat Phra Kaew, which houses the famous Emerald Buddha.
Experiencing the Local Culture in Chiang Mai
Chiang Mai is a city in northern Thailand that is known for its rich cultural heritage and stunning natural scenery. The city is home to over 300 temples, many of which date back to the 13th and 14th centuries. One of the most popular temples in Chiang Mai is Wat Phra That Doi Suthep, which is located on a mountain overlooking the city. In addition to its temples, Chiang Mai is also known for its night markets, where you can find everything from street food to handmade crafts.
Relaxing on the Beaches of Phuket
Phuket is an island in southern Thailand that is known for its stunning beaches and crystal-clear waters. The island is home to several popular beaches, including Patong Beach, which is known for its nightlife and water sports. If you’re looking for a quieter beach experience, you might consider visiting Kata Beach or Karon Beach. In addition to its beaches, Phuket is also home to several cultural attractions, including the Big Buddha, which is a large statue of Buddha located on a hill overlooking the island.
Navigating Through Thailand’s Cities
Getting around Thailand’s cities can be challenging, especially if you don’t speak the local language. However, there are several options available to travelers, including public transportation, taxis, and tuk-tuks. If you’re planning to use public transportation, you might consider purchasing a Rabbit Card, which is a reloadable card that can be used on buses and trains in Bangkok. Additionally, many cities in Thailand offer bicycle rentals, which can be a great way to explore the city at your own pace.

Q: What is the best time of year to visit Thailand’s cities?
A: The best time of year to visit Thailand’s cities depends on your preferences and travel plans. The high season is from November to February, when the weather is cooler and drier. However, this is also the busiest time of year, so you can expect larger crowds and higher prices. If you’re looking for a quieter experience, you might consider visiting during the low season, which is from May to October.
